Episode #136 Grandpa Al's Legacy Lives On in This Whiskey | Tasting Wildcat Distillery - Tillmans Whiskey

🥃 Every great whiskey has a story—and sometimes that story starts in a farm field generations ago. One of our favorite things is discovering how a whiskey got its name. At Wildcat Distillery, their Tillman's Whiskey is more than just a bottle—it's a tribute to family legacy. Named after their Grandpa Al, the original Wildcat Tillman who first planted the grain that would become part of the family's story, this whiskey honors the hard work, perseverance, and farming heritage that helped make it all possible. It's a reminder that great whiskey isn't just made in the distillery—it's rooted in the people and traditions behind it. 👉 Listen now to hear the story behind Tillman's Whiskey and why Grandpa Al would be proud.

Episode #135 - How a Custom Still Mix-Up Became a Happy Accident at Lonely Oak Distillery

🥃 Sometimes the best things in whiskey happen by accident. You don't just order a custom still and have it show up next week. Building a distillery still can take months—or even years. And when projects stretch that long, mistakes can happen. That's exactly what happened at Lonely Oak Distillery. What started as a mix-up during the still-building process resulted in a unique combination of stainless steel and copper that wasn't exactly what was ordered... but turned out to be a happy accident. The story behind how their still came to be is funny, unexpected, and a great reminder that innovation sometimes comes from embracing the unexpected. 👉 Listen now to hear the story behind one of the most unique stills we've encountered and how it became part of Lonely Oak's whiskey-making journey.
